@charset "UTF-8";
/* Castrol Gallery*/
/* 
CASTROL COLOR SCHEME
GREEN -- #009A4E;
RED -- #ED1B2F;
GREY -- #333;
*/ 
/* ROUND CORNER FANCY FOR MODERN WEB BROWSER
* -moz-border-radius-topleft  / -webkit-border-top-left-radius
* -moz-border-radius-topright / -webkit-border-top-right-radius
* -moz-border-radius-bottomleft / -webkit-border-bottom-left-radius
* -moz-border-radius-bottomright / -webkit-border-bottom-right-radius
*/
/*
use "_" to define the CSS properties that use for IE6 only
use "/" to define the CSS properties that use for IE7 only
*/



/*HOME--IMAGE GALLERY TEASER*/
.gallery-teaser-tmb {width:45px; float:left; margin:30px 20px 0px -20px; padding:0px;}
.gallery-teaser-tmb ul {list-style:none; margin:0px; padding:0px;}
.gallery-teaser-tmb ul li {display:block; margin:-3px 0px 5px 0px; padding:0px; width:45px; height:45px; background-image:url(../img/bg-gallery-tmb-45px.png);}
span.gallery-teaser-tmb-shade {display:block; width:20px; height:40px; position:absolute; z-index:20; background-image:url(../img/ol-gallery-tmb-45px.png);}
span.gallery-teaser-tmb-viewed {position:relative; z-index:30; display:block; width:60px; height:30px; background-color:#000; color:#FFF; margin:-43px 0px 0px 40px; padding:5px; font-size:12px; font-weight:bold; text-decoration:none;/*IE7 HACKED*/ /margin:0px 0px 0px 0px; /position:absolute; -moz-border-radius-topright:5px; -webkit-border-top-right-radius:5px; -moz-border-radius-bottomright:5px; -webkit-border-bottom-right-radius:5px; }
.gallery-teaser-tmb ul li span.gallery-teaser-tmb-viewed {display:none;}
.gallery-teaser-tmb ul li:hover span.gallery-teaser-tmb-viewed {display:block;}

span.teaser-gal-star {display:block; width:160px; height:30px; position:absolute; z-index:20; margin:-80px 0px 0px 10px; padding:7px 0px 0px 40px; color:#FFF; font-size:14px; background-image:url(../img/bg-star.png); background-repeat:no-repeat; /*IE7 HACKED*/ /margin:-80px 0px 0px 10px; /width:120px; /position:relative; }

/*HOME--VDO IMAGE TEASER*/
.gallery-teaser-vdo {display:block; padding:0px; margin:20px 0px 0px 40px; float:left;}
.gallery-teaser-vdo-player {border:#CCC 1px solid; width:320px; height:240px; display:block; float:left; padding:7px 7px 35px 7px; background-color:#FFF; background-image:url(../img/bg-gradient-480.jpg);}
.gallery-teaser-vdo-tmb {width:80px; float:left; margin:0px; padding:0px;}
.gallery-teaser-vdo-tmb ul  {width:80px; list-style:none; margin:0px; padding:0px;}
.gallery-teaser-vdo-tmb ul li { float:left; display:block; width:80px; height:60px; margin:5px 0px 0px -1px; padding:0px; border:#CCC 1px solid; }

span.vdo-teaser-tmb-shade {display:block; width:20px; height:60px; position:absolute; z-index:20; background-image:url(../img/ol-gallery-tmb-45px.png); background-repeat:repeat-y;}
span.vdo-teaser-tmb-viewed {position:relative; z-index:30; display:block; width:60px; height:30px; background-color:#000; color:#FFF; margin:-63px 0px 0px 80px; padding:5px; font-size:12px; font-weight:bold; text-decoration:none;/*IE7 HACKED*/  /margin:-60px 0px 0px 80px; -moz-border-radius-topright:5px; -webkit-border-top-right-radius:5px; -moz-border-radius-bottomright:5px; -webkit-border-bottom-right-radius:5px;}

.gallery-teaser-vdo-tmb ul li span.vdo-teaser-tmb-viewed {display:none;}
.gallery-teaser-vdo-tmb li:hover span.vdo-teaser-tmb-viewed {display:block;}

#submit-media-banner-v {width:80px; height:160px; float:left; display:block;}
#submit-media-banner-v a {width:80px; height:160px; background-image:url(../img/banner-submit-media-act.jpg); display:block; text-decoration:none;}
#submit-media-banner-v a:hover {background-image:url(../img/banner-submit-media-hov.jpg); text-decoration:none;}
span.submit-media-banner-v-shadow {background-image:url(../img/banner-submit-media-shade.png); background-repeat:no-repeat; width:20px; height:160px; display:block; margin:0px -20px 0px 0px; float:right;}

span.teaser-vdo-star {display:block; width:160px; height:30px; position:absolute; z-index:20; margin:0px 0px 0px -10px; padding:10px 0px 0px 35px; color:#666; font-size:14px; background-image:url(../img/bg-star-trans.png); background-repeat:no-repeat; /*IE7 HACKED*/ /margin:0px 0px 0px -10px; /width:120px; /position:relative; }

#submit-media-banner-h {width:480px; height:80px; margin:0px; padding:0px; display:block; float:left;}
#submit-media-banner-h a { width:480px; height:80px; display:block; background-image:url(../img/banner-submit-media-h.jpg); background-position: 0px 0px; text-decoration:none;}
#submit-media-banner-h a:hover { background-image:url(../img/banner-submit-media-h.jpg); background-position: 0px 80px; text-decoration:none;}
span.shadow-bottom {width:240px; height:20px; background-image:url(../img/shadow-bottom.png); display:block; position:relative; margin:0px auto;}